Common causes
Most likely first
- Faulty or failing oxygen sensor in Bank 1 Sensor 3
- Vacuum leak in the exhaust system
- Fuel pressure regulator malfunction
- Issues with the Engine Control Module (ECM) or sensor wiring
- Exhaust system leaks or damage
